To cure sweaty hands and feet, we must first find out the cause and determine whether it is pathological hyperhidrosis. Pathological hyperhidrosis is caused by certain diseases. For example, patients with systemic diseases such as tuberculosis, rickets, some hyperthyroidism, diabetes and mental disorders may develop secondary hyperhidrosis of the hands. However, pathological hyperhidrosis is accompanied by other symptoms besides excessive sweating. Excluding pathological diseases, the most effective way to cure sweaty hands and feet is mainly herbal Chinese medicine conditioning and surgical treatment. Other methods such as ionization therapy and antiperspirant lotion can only temporarily suppress excessive sweating but cannot fundamentally solve the problem of sweaty hands and feet. The current surgical method has been changed to thoracoscopic thoracic sympathectomy. Although it is effective quickly, patients often experience compensatory hyperhidrosis sequelae after surgery. Therefore, in unavoidable situations, it is more appropriate to give priority to herbal conditioning. The sympathetic nerves that control the sweat glands in the hands are located in the second and third thoracic vertebrae, which are approximately located on the nipple line, and a little higher on both sides of the back spine. As long as the sympathetic nerves in these two sections are cut off, the purpose of stopping sweating in the hands can be achieved. Although surgical treatment for hand sweating is indeed effective, compensatory sweating often occurs after the hand sweating stops. Compensatory sweating means that after surgery, sweating in the upper body (above the nipples) almost stops, while the lower body is often wet. Except in extremely cold weather, compensatory sweating persists and does not decrease over time, but may increase instead. This is one of the most unbearable sequelae after surgery. |
